There are also correspondencies establishing that Micheal is actually the Son of God. Daniel after making the reference to Michael(Daniel10:13) recorded a prophecy reaching down to"the time of the end" and then stated:" And at that time shall Michael stand up, the great prince which standeth for the children of thy people(daniel's people)......and at that time thy people shall be delivered, everyone that shall be found written in the book"(Daniel12:1)
Michael's standing up was to be associated with " a time of trouble such as never was since there was a nation even to that same time"(Da12:1) In Daniel's prohecy, standing up frequently refers to the action of the king, either taking up his royal power or acting effectively in his capacity as king.(DA11:2-4,7) This supports the conlusion that Michael is Jesus Christ, since Jesus is god's appointed king, commisioned to destroy all the nations at Har-Magedon.(Re11:15;16:14-16)
